Title: The Innovations of Marc Stroelin

Introduction

Marc Stroelin is a notable inventor based in Neuhausen,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of electric drive systems and group transmission devices. With a total of three patents to his name, Stroelin's work reflects a commitment to advancing automotive technology.

Latest Patents

Stroelin's latest patents include an innovative electric drive system. This system features a group transmission with a main group and a range group, utilizing a planetary gear set. The design incorporates first and second input shafts coupled with electric engines, enhancing efficiency and performance. Another patent focuses on a group transmission device, which includes an upshift assembly and a downshift assembly, showcasing Stroelin's expertise in complex mechanical systems.
